The Effective Kähler Potential And Extra Space-Time Dimensions | T.E. Clark
; S.T. Love
; | Date: |
21 Dec 1998 | Journal: | Phys.Rev. D60 (1999) 025005 | Subject: | hep-th | Abstract: | The effects of extra space-time dimensions on the Wilsonian effective Kähler potential and the perturbative one loop effective Kähler potential are determined within the framework of an Abelian gauge theory with N=2 supersymmetric field content. The relation between the Kähler metric and the effective gauge couplings which leads to the absence of radiative corrections to the Kähler potential is expressed as a function of the radius of compactification of a fifth dimension. In general, the quantum corrections to the low energy Kähler potential are shown to grow with this radius reflecting the underlying higher dimensional nature of the theory. | Source: | arXiv, hep-th/9901103 | Services: | Forum | Review | PDF | Favorites |
